Who are Aged Machine?

Aged Machine are Jeremy D. Camp and, occasionally, Todd R. Jackson; two longtime friends, self-taught computer geeks and musicians who share an interest in electronic music of (just about) all sorts.

They began releasing music as Aged Machine in 1998, shortly after a move to the Portland area.

Originally named for the somewhat outdated equipment used in the beginning, Aged Machine started out with an 80’s era Atari computer as a sequencer, with 80’s era Roland synthesizers and samplers.

Aged Machine have produced 6 albums, slowly moving away from hardware synthesizers to the world of computer generated synthesis and music production.

In addition to the Aged Machine project, Jeremy is half of the synth-pop duo Clever Things.
